Section 2: Eligibility Criteria

Before you start the application process, make sure you know CLAT eligibility for CLAT 2025 and CLAT registration. Here are the key requirements:

  • For UG Programs: The minimum educational qualification for candidates is a 10+2 examination or its equivalent with a minimum of 45 percent (40 percent for SC/ST candidates. Candidates who will appear for their board exams in 2025 can also apply.
  • For PG Programs: Applicants should have a Bachelor's degree in Law (3 years or 5 years) with at least 50% marks (45% for SC/ST candidates).

Before registering for the exam, it is important that you meet these eligibility criteria, otherwise you will be disqualified.

Section 3: Application Process

Ready to apply? The CLAT 2025 registration process is simple. Here’s how to get started:

  • Register: Sign up with your basic details like name, email address and phone number.
  • Fill in the Application Form: Fill out the application form with all the needed information such as an educational qualification and a preference for law colleges.
  • Upload Documents: You will have to upload scanned copies of your photograph and signature and any other documents as required.
  • Pay the Application Fee: The UG program application fee is INR 4,000 for general candidates and INR 3,500 for SC/ST candidates. Be sure to pick your payment method carefully.
  • Submit the Application: Before applying, review all your details. The confirmation is once submitted, keep a copy of it for records.

Keep in mind to submit your application by the deadline, and late submissions are rarely taken.

Section 4: Exam Pattern and Syllabus

To do well in the exam, it is critical to understand the exam pattern and syllabus. The CLAT 2025 will consist of 150 multiple-choice questions divided into five sections:

  • Comprehension of, and interpretation of, passages.
  • General Knowledge - About current affairs, history and social issues.
  • Understanding of legal principles and reasoning through problems Legal Reasoning.
  • Critical thinking and reasoning ability assessment - Logical Reasoning.
  • Basic mathematical skills and data interpretation – Quantitative Techniques.
